RBS50 Satellite Won't sync - even in same room

Hi,

 

Had to reinstall and reimage the firmware on my router recently after a power brownout.  

The router now seems to be working just fine, but I am unable to get my satellite to sync. 

 

When I follow the sync procedure I get the puslsing white light for a couple of minutes and then solid magenta (on the satellite)..

 

I have made sure both the router and satellite have the same firmware image.  (V2.7.1.60)

I've moved the router and satellite witihin 5 feet of each other.  I've tried them in separate rooms.

I've tried factory resetting the satellite.

I've tried setting the SSID of my router back to the same SSID that the satellite appears to boot up with (the factory values from the label on the bottom of the unit)

 

I've tried using the Orbi app.

I've tried just pressing 'sync buttons' on the router and the satellite,

I've tried logging into the router and using the web interface to initiate a sync.   

 

All have the same result ... a few minutes of pulsing white then the router goes back to 'no light' and the satellite goes solid magenta.

 

I remember having lots of trouble getting them to sync the first time I installed the system.  But this seems to be worse. 

 

Any ideas would be much appreiated!   


  • Update:  Managed to get the satellite back online by connecting it directly to the router with a cat5 cable.  The status changed to 'syncing config' and then it picked up the correct SSID and admin password.

     

    Not sure why it couldn't sync over the wireless?
